Log Home Siding Installation in Boston, MA
Log home siding installation services involve attaching durable and aesthetically appealing siding materials to the exterior of log homes. This process helps protect the structure from weather elements, enhances curb appeal, and can improve insulation. Projects typically include replacing old or damaged siding, upgrading to more modern or maintenance-friendly options, or completing new construction log homes. Homeowners often seek guidance on the best siding materials for their climate and style preferences, as well as understanding the scope of work involved in ensuring a long-lasting, attractive finish.
Before requesting log home siding installation, property owners usually want to know about the different siding options available, such as wood, vinyl, or fiber cement, and how each performs in terms of durability and maintenance. They may also inquire about the preparation process, the expected lifespan of the siding, and how installation can impact the overall appearance of the home. Clarifying these details can help homeowners make informed decisions to achieve the desired look and functionality for their log home exterior.

Log Home Siding Installation Questions
What types of log home siding are available? Common options include cedar, pine, and engineered wood siding, each offering different looks and durability levels for log homes.
How does siding installation impact a log home's appearance? Proper installation enhances the natural beauty of logs and provides a smooth, even surface for a refined look.
Is log home siding installation suitable for existing structures? Yes, it can be added to existing log homes to improve insulation, appearance, or protect the logs from weathering.
What should property owners consider before installing log home siding? It's important to choose siding material that matches the home's style and to ensure proper ventilation and moisture control.
